Quick Answer
- The best driveway bollards range from $50 to $300 each, depending on material and features.
- Top-rated options include removable bollards for flexibility and permanent ones for security.
- Consider installation costs: professional installation can add $100 to $500 per bollard.
- Look for bollards with reflective strips to enhance visibility, especially at night.
- Check local regulations regarding heights and placements to avoid fines.

Practical Tips for Choosing the Best Driveway Bollards
When investing in the best driveway bollards, consider security features. Look for bollards made from durable materials like steel or high-density plastic. These options resist impacts, preventing unauthorized vehicles from encroaching on your parking space. Additionally, choose bollards that are easy to install and maintain, saving you time and money in the long run.
Next, evaluate the height and visibility of the bollards. Opt for models that are at least 36 inches tall to ensure they are noticeable from a distance. Adding reflective tape can enhance visibility at night, keeping your property safe and your parking space secure.
